Output 112d252516ae1f51c8fb2a2be3511815c3b726645dfbf667f0b069b5151858ae:2

value
156350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f34544954ebb67761d0fc48332c38dce68bbf517 OP_EQUAL
address
3PsK6ycLVrjupDbD8wZGRtQjqtYEMzm5yK
transaction
112d252516ae1f51c8fb2a2be3511815c3b726645dfbf667f0b069b5151858ae
spent
true